The Race Route
Self-Supported · ~1,111 km
The full Ascend Armenia race traverses the entire length of the country on gravel tracks, mountain passes, and ancient roads. Riders must be entirely self-sufficient — no support crews, no resupply beyond what you can carry or find.
- ~1,111 km point-to-point
- Fully self-supported bikepacking
- Unlimited time window to finish
- GPS tracking for all participants
The Touring Route
Self-Supported · Flexible Distance
A simplified, more accessible version of the full route. The touring track lets you experience Armenia’s best landscapes at your own pace, without the racing dynamic. Perfect for riders who want to explore but aren’t ready for the full race commitment.
- Shorter, more manageable distance
- No registration required to ride
- Follow at your own pace
- Same incredible landscapes
What to Expect on the Route
High Mountain Passes
The route crosses some of Armenia’s most dramatic passes, reaching elevations above 3,000m. Expect everything from smooth tarmac to rocky doubletrack.
Ancient Roads & Villages
Gravel tracks wind through centuries-old villages and past medieval monasteries. You’ll ride roads that few outsiders have ever seen.
Varied Terrain
From the lush green valleys of the north to the volcanic highlands of the south, the route covers the full spectrum of what Armenia has to offer.
